在以太坊区块链生态系统中,去中心化应用(DApp)正日益改变着我们与数字世界的交互方式,从去中心化金融(DeFi)到非同质化代币(NFT),再到各种游戏和社会应用,DApp的繁荣离不开以太坊作为底层基础设施的支持,对于每一位DApp开发者和用户而言,“矿工费”(Miner Fee或Gas Fee)都是一个无法回避且至关重要的概念,它直接影响着DApp的使用成本、用户体验以及开发者的运营策略。

什么是以太坊矿工费?

以太坊矿工费,更准确地说是“Gas Fee”,是指用户为了在以太坊网络上执行操作(如发送交易、调用智能合约、铸造NFT等)而支付给矿工(或验证者,在PoS后)的费用,这笔费用以以太坊(ETH)及其最小单位“Gwei”(1 ETH = 1,000,000,000 Gwei)支付。

“Gas”这个词的比喻很形象:它就像驱动汽车前进的燃料,每一次操作都需要消耗一定量的“Gas”,Gas费用由两个主要因素决定:

  1. Gas Limit( gas 限制):指用户愿意为某笔交易执行的最大Gas量,这相当于油箱的容量,设定了一个上限,防止交易因代码错误而无限消耗资源。
  2. Gas Price( gas 价格):指用户愿意为每单位Gas支付的价格,这相当于每升汽油的价格,Gas价格越高,矿工(验证者)打包该交易的优先级越高,交易确认速度越快。

矿工费 = Gas Limit × Gas Price

矿工费在DApp生态中的核心作用

  1. 激励网络安全性:矿工费是激励矿工(验证者)维护以太坊网络安全、打包交易、出块(或验证区块)的主要动力,足够的矿工费确保了网络的高效和持续运行。
  2. 防止网络滥用:通过要求用户支付Gas费,以太坊有效防止了恶意用户发起大量垃圾交易攻击网络,保障了有限网络资源的合理分配。
  3. 影响DApp用户体验:这是用户最直接的感知,过高的Gas费可能会让小额交易变得不划算,劝退部分用户,尤其是对于高频小额支付的DApp(如游戏、微支付),Gas费的波动性也给用户带来了成本的不确定性。
  4. 决定DApp开发与运营策略
    • 开发者:在设计DApp时,必须考虑Gas费优化,复杂的智能合约逻辑会消耗更多Gas,从而增加用户使用成本,开发者需要在功能丰富性和成本效率之间找到平衡,通过合约升级、状态通道、Layer 2扩容方案等手段降低用户Gas消耗。
    • 运营者:对于一些DApp项目方,可能会选择为用户的特定操作支付Gas费(空投、交互式活动),以提高用户参与度,但这本身也是一笔不小的开支,需要精细的成本测算。

随机配图